Output 16618684d02a58094d27120ad45110a3733b23f10c8198715e633a4816d0dc40:0

value
5999900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ca8151156a7ef2c09f44ee93add7a2c66085e3e OP_EQUAL
address
MDRt8W7DhQF3JhSFfr3xs1LibTEkMHueHo
transaction
16618684d02a58094d27120ad45110a3733b23f10c8198715e633a4816d0dc40
spent
true